Manufacturing PMI at a 14-month high of 54.3 in Feb
According to Nikkei India Services Purchasing Managers’ Index (PMI) data, new work orders,especially international ones,helped propel manufacturing sector activity to a 14-month high of 54.3 after two straight months of contraction. PMI or a Purchasing Managers’ Index (PMI) is an indicator of business activity — both in the manufacturing and services sectors. More LHB coaches to be made this year
Railway Minister has said that the Rail Coach Factory is targeting to manufacture 1,422 Linke Hofmann Busch (LHB) coaches in 2018-19. LHB coaches are the passenger coaches of Indian Railways that have been developed by Linke-Hofmann-Busch of Germany.These coaches are produced by Rail Coach Factory in Kapurthala,Punjab. Swine flu cases on the rise in Gujarat
Swine flu cases has been on a rise in Gujarat. Of late, nearly 100 new cases are reported from across the state per day. Swine flu is a highly contagious acute respiratory disease of pigs caused by type A influenza virus. Swine flu viruses do not normally infect humans.
